Yes I have the same, and when i click on users it goes to '/content/view/full/5/' and shows the list of users in the body section, but the 'Content' tab is highlighted and the sub-nav below is the Content section sub-nav.
Hence my inability to find 'Roles' in the beginning...
Thats very odd. The user tab should be highlighted after clicking that link.
Have you enabled debugging? Perhaps there are errors being reported that will help with tracking down where the problem lies? Make sure you clear the cache after enabling debugging.
- Go to setup -> sections.
- Check if a section is there and assigned to the users root node, if not create it and assign to the users root node
- Check if the contentnavigation part is saying Users, if not change it - Clear caches
-> Now your left menu with roles will be back when hit the Users tab
It depends on how you install ez publish: I got it too recently with a clean install (no demo data) at home. I never bothered to delve deeper on this, just looked at the defined sections and assignments to navigation parts and added things if they were missing.
Ok, now thanks to both your help I have finally resolved this. It was entirely my fault... :$
I had had problems assigning sections to folders in the content section and I had removed the default 'Standard section', 'Users' etc. That had broken the tab links!
